Apache Ant是一款功能可以进行经常用的软件编译、测试以及部属等融合在一起的编程经常用的软件,多用于java环境的经常用的软件开发,让编程人员们更加方便的进行经常用的软件的编写.有需要的朋友就来万能驱动网下载吧!
apache Ant介绍
java开发工具,程序员可以自己扩展Ant。程序员可以自己写java程序来扩展Ant,创建自己的tasks。经常用的软件功能强集编译 测试 部署等步骤联系在一起的自动化工具,大多用于Java环境中的经常用的软件开发,由Apache官方开发,经常用的软件由Java语言编写,具有很强的快平台操作性。
apache Ant 1.9.7功能说明
跨平台性
Ant是纯Java语言编写的,所以具有很好的跨平台性。
操作简单
Ant是由一个内置任务和可选任务组成的。
Ant运行时需要一个xml文件(构建文件)。
Ant通过调用target树,就可以执行各种task。每个task实现了特定接口对象。
由于Ant构建文件 是XML格式的文件,所以很容易维护和书写,而且结构很清晰。
Ant可以集成到开发环境中
由于Ant的跨平台性和操作简单的特点,它很容易集成到一些开发环 境中去。
Apache Ant,是一个将经常用的软件编译、测试、部署等步骤联系在一起加以自动化的一个工具。
大多用于Java环境中的经常用的软件开发。
Apache Ant配置环境与安装
解压ant安装包在D:\SWE下
环境变量配置
ANT_HOME D:\SWE\apache-ant-1.8.4
CLASSPATH ;%ANT_HOME%lib;
PATH ;%ANT_HOME%bin;
测试是否安装成功
在cmd命令方式下输入:ant -version
出现问题
1)Unable to locate tools.jar. Expected to find it in C:\Program Files\Java\jre6\lib
命令行敲ant命令后提示:“Unable to locate tools.jar. Expected to find it in C:\Program Files\Java\jre6\lib”;ANT_HOME环境变量已经配置;
解决途径:将“C:\Program Files\Java\jdk1.6.0_16\lib”目录下的tools.jar文件拷贝到“C:\Program Files\Java\jre6\lib”目录下,重新运行命令ant,运行正常,问题解决。
2)在cmd命令中:输入ant,如果输出: Buildfile:build.xml does not exist!
Build failed
说明ant安装成功。
运行第一个ant脚本
在D:\ant_home\apache-ant-1.8.1\bin\下面新建目录build,再在该目录下新建目录src
同时在src目录下新建HelloWorld.java
内容说明
package test.ant;
public class HelloWorld{
public static void main(String[] args){
System.out.println("Hello World");
}
};
编写build.xml文件保存到D:\ant_home\apache-ant-1.8.1\bin\
内容如下
运行:
Buildfile: D:\ant_home\apache-ant-1.8.1\bin\build.xml
[echo] ----------- HelloWorld 1.0 [2010] ------------
init:
[echo] mkdir build/classes
compile:
[javac] Compiling 1 source file to D:\ant_home\apache-ant-1.8.1\bin\build\classes
build:
[jar] Building jar: D:\ant_home\apache-ant-1.8.1\bin\build\hello.jar
run:
[java] Hello World
BUILD SUCCESSFUL
Total time: 1 second
检查在目录D:\ant_home\apache-ant-1.8.1\bin\build下生成hello.jar
版权声明:apache ant 64位所展示的资源内容均来自于第三方用户上传分享,您所下载的资源内容仅供个人学习交流使用,严禁用于商业用途,软件的著作权归原作者所有,如果有侵犯您的权利,请来信告知,我们将及时撤销。
软件下载信息清单:
软件名称 | 发布日期 | 文件大小 | 下载文件名 |
---|---|---|---|
apache ant 64位安装包 | 2024年11月5日 | 8.0M | apacheant_qudong9.com.zip |
软件评论